[C] Otwieranie plikow .bmp

0

Witam,
Czytajac specyfokacje formatu bmp, dochodze do miejsca gdzie jest napisane, ze kazda linia danych obrazowych, jest wyrowanana do wieloktronosci 4 bajtow. Ok, wporzadku. Natomiast, kiedy moje proby konczyly sie fiaskiem, zagladnalem do pliku w hexedytorze...
I teraz moje pytanie brzmi: Dlaczego w obrazie 4 bitowym, o wymiarach 4x4, po kazdej linii sa dodawane dwa bajty zerowe ? W obrazach 8 bitowych o tym samym wymiarze, takich sytuacji nie ma. Czy nie doczytalem czegos ?
Pozdrawiam.

0

Dlaczego w obrazie 4 bitowym, o wymiarach 4x4, po kazdej linii sa dodawane dwa bajty zerowe ?

4bity/pix razy 4pix/scanline daje 16, a to dwa bajty, więc dodajesz 2 następne coby było wyrównane do 4.

1 użytkowników online, w tym zalogowanych: 0, gości: 1